html中表单有什么作用和功能

HTML中的表单(form)是一种用于收集用户输入的元素,在web开发中起着非常重要的作用和功能。它允许用户提交数据,对数据进行处理并进行页面跳转或响应。

表单的基本结构如下:

```html

```

其中,`action`属性指定了表单提交后的目标URL地址,`method`属性用来指定使用哪种HTTP方法来提交表单。

接下来,让我们来详细了解一下表单的作用和功能。

1. 收集用户输入数据:表单最主要的作用是收集用户通过各种输入元素(如文本框、下拉选项、复选框等)输入的数据。用户可以填写个人信息、留言、订阅电子邮件等。

2. 提交数据给服务器端:通过点击提交按钮,用户可以将填写的数据提交给服务器端进行处理。服务器端可以使用不同的编程语言(如PHPJavaPython等)来处理这些数据,实现复杂的功能。

3. 页面跳转和响应:在表单提交后,服务器端可以根据数据的处理结果,返回不同的页面或信息给用户。这可以是一个新的页面,也可以是一条成功或失败的提示信息。

4. 用户认证和登录:表单常常用于实现用户认证和登录功能。用户可以在表单中输入用户名和密码,通过提交表单进行身份验证。

5. 数据校验和验证:表单可以对用户输入的数据进行校验和验证。例如,可以使用正则表达式进行数据格式的验证,或者限制输入长度、输入范围等。

除了以上常见的功能,表单还有一些进阶的用法和特点:

1. 文件上传:表单可以用来实现文件上传功能,通过`enctype`属性设置为`multipart/form-data`来支持文件上传。

2. 表单元素的分组和布局:可以使用`fieldset`和`legend`元素来对表单元素进行分组,并使用CSS来控制表单的布局。

3. 表单元素的默认值和自动填充:可以使用`value`属性设置表单元素的默认值,或者使用浏览器的自动填充功能来填充已保存的表单数据。

4. 表单验证和提交的事件控制:可以使用JavaScript来对表单的提交事件进行拦截和控制,以实现一些自定义的验证和处理逻辑。

需要注意的是,为了保障用户输入的安全性,开发者需要对用户提交的数据进行有效的验证和过滤,防止恶意代码注入和非法操作。

总结来说,HTML中的表单在web开发中非常重要。它能够收集并处理用户输入的数据,实现各种功能,如用户认证、文件上传、数据校验等。同时,开发者还需要注意数据的安全性和合法性,以及对表单的交互行为进行控制和验证。

壹涵网络我们是一家专注于网站建设、企业营销、网站关键词排名、AI内容生成、新媒体营销和短视频营销等业务的公司。我们拥有一支优秀的团队,专门致力于为客户提供优质的服务。

我们致力于为客户提供一站式的互联网营销服务,帮助客户在激烈的市场竞争中获得更大的优势和发展机会!

点赞(94) 打赏

评论列表 共有 0 条评论

暂无评论
立即
投稿
发表
评论
返回
顶部